CVE-ID: CVE-2020-14928
Exploit availability: No
DescriptionThe vulnerability allows a remote non-authenticated attacker to manipulate data.
evolution-data-server (eds) through 3.36.3 has a STARTTLS buffering issue that affects SMTP and POP3. When a server sends a "begin TLS" response, eds reads additional data and evaluates it in a TLS context, aka "response injection."
MitigationUpdate the affected package evolution-data-server to the latest version.
